
Where are the most exclusive destinations in Europe? The European Best Destinations platform has published its ranking for 2022, including 10 luxury holiday destinations in different parts of the continent that stand out for their natural beauty and luxury lifestyle. Let's have a closer look at the most exclusive destinations in Europe including Positano and Capri in Italy.
Marbella, Málaga

This small city in the Spanish province of Málaga ranks as Europe's top luxury destination. Famous for its exclusive designer boutiques, world-class golf courses and the extravagant Puerto Banús district, Marbella is full of trendy clubs and restaurants.
Positano, Italy

Italy's first appearance and one of the jewels in the crown of the top luxury European destinations takes us to the Amalfi Coast, one of the most heavenly places in the Italian peninsula. With its charming architecture and unique position built in the middle of the mountains while overlooking the sea, Positano is full of luxury, charm and history. Legend has it that this idyllic spot was actually built by the god Neptune in a bid to win over a nymph in love.
Madeira, Portugal

Madeira is said to be one of Europe's most welcoming destinations, with its locals giving a warm welcome to visitors all year round. Filled with luxury hotels surrounded by stunning nature, the Portuguese island of Madeira is home to some of the best customer service in the world.
Capri, Italia

Back in Italy, we're off to the spectacular island of Capri, quite possibly the most luxurious island in the Mediterranean. Known for its spectacular natural beauty, such as the majestic faraglioni (coastal and oceanic rock formations eroded by waves). Capri is a destination where much of the Italian and European rich and famous love to jet set.
Gstaad, Switzerland

The Swiss ski resort of Gstaad is known for its luxury hotels which overlook the soaring mountains and impressive slopes that make this area so attractive. With snow for a large part of the year, between October and May, this charming town is a favourite holiday destination for both royalty and celebs.
St. Barts, France

St. Barts is the French-speaking Caribbean destination of choice for the holidays of the world's most influential individuals. The exclusivity of the island and pleasant year-round temperatures provide for a lifestyle beyond compare, as well as being the perfect spot to escape the cold.
Megève, France

Heading back to snow-covered mountains, this time we're in Megève which is home to one of the best ski resorts on the whole continent. It is home to 260km of impressive ski slopes, not to mention exclusive 5-star hotels that show the history and authenticity of the town.
Monte Carlo, Monaco

Monte Carlo is also a celeb favourite and home to extravagance and opulence at its finest. A trip to the world-famous casino is a must, or how about a trip to the beach or on a luxury yacht?
Montreux, Switzerland

Montreux is a perched on the edge of Lake Geneva with a backdrop of step hills, and with its 5-star hotels with guaranteed privacy, it's clear why this destination is one of the most exclusive in the world.
Sveti Stefan, Montenegro

Sveti Stefan is a small islet and 5-star hotel resort on the Adriatic coast that looks like something that has been taken directly from a movie. This unique spot is perfect for a honeymoon or romantic weekend break, topped of by access to private beaches and stunning views.
